Output 06efe286ac787e78e206fab5f12736354dfa934b7aa89c7b363fc3ef9b8cceda:1

value
36841453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 545bedcd854096a94607beefe3ef0a36c39a49fb OP_EQUAL
address
39P4ozQpfDAVdWmNLn2BBU2m9rDqkpREix
transaction
06efe286ac787e78e206fab5f12736354dfa934b7aa89c7b363fc3ef9b8cceda
confirmations
149587
spent
true